Reviews: Waitomo Caves & Rotorua - Te Puia Small-Group Tour from Auckland
Guest User2024-07-30
Such a great trip! Grant (or Grant but in a kiwi accent) was a great tour guide. He was very knowledgeable and taught us a lot about the culture and history during the long van rides. Glowworm caves were cool but the highlight for me was definitely the geysers. The whole experience was great and am so grateful that they offer a trip like this including transport since Rotorua is quite a distance away. Note: this experience did not include a Māori performance or haka. If I read the description better I wouldve known that but that is the only thing I was a little bummed about. The experience is great, but just note what is actually included if thats what you are looking for.
